It is a fairly esoteric topic and the annotations are rarely needed
(the low-level kernel code is quite special in this regard), so don't
get too upset with the authors! (I don't talk about them in my book
either---there simply was no obvious need/opportunity to introduce
them).
The directives are explained in the Itanium assembler manual from Intel.
http://www.intel.com/software/products/opensource/tools1/tol_whte2.htm
Chapter 7 is the one of interest here.
